    MANERA, FORMA, MODO De manera + ((adjetivo)) Cuando de manera + ((adjetivo)) añade información sobre una acción, la traducción más frecuente al inglés es un adverbio terminado en -ly. En inglés este tipo de adverbio es mucho más común que el equivalente - mente español: Todos estos cambios ocurren de manera natural All these changes happen naturally La Constitución prohíbe de manera expresa la especulación inmobiliaria The Constitution expressly forbids speculation in real estate ► De manera + ((adjetivo)) también se puede traducir por in a + ((adjetvo)) + way si no existe un adverbio terminado en -ly que equivalga al adjetivo: Se lo dijo de manera amistosa He said it to her in a friendly way ► En los casos en que se quiere hacer hincapié en la manera de hacer algo, se puede utilizar tanto un adverbio en -ly como la construcción in a + ((adjetivo)) + way, aunque esta última posibilidad es más frecuente: Tienes que intentar comportarte de manera responsable You must try to behave responsibly o in a responsible way Ellos podrán ayudarte a manejar tu negocio de manera profesional They'll be able to help you run your business professionally o in a professional way Para otros usos y ejemplos ver manera, forma, modo
